Web23 de set. de 2024 · While they are moved by air, planes land at airports and not aquariums, and containers are then transported by trucks. Specialized equipment is also used at airports and onboard planes, including forklifts, flatbeds, and straight box vans. Trucks are fitted with thermometers and cameras to track air temperature and monitor animals.
WebThe whales are conditioned to swim onto stretchers, customised to their length and size, and outfitted with holes for their pectoral fins, Tuttle says.
